The OM 471 Engine: A Workhorse of Efficiency and Power

The OM 471 engine is arguably the most ubiquitous and adaptable engine in the Actros range. It’s a testament to sophisticated engineering, offering a perfect balance between raw power and remarkable fuel economy. This inline six-cylinder engine is available in various displacements and power ratings, catering to a wide spectrum of transport needs.

  • Power Output: Typically ranges from 420 hp to 530 hp, depending on the specific configuration.
  • Torque: Delivers impressive torque figures, often exceeding 2,000 Nm, crucial for heavy hauling and tackling inclines with ease.
  • Turbocharging: Features a state-of-the-art turbocharger with variable geometry for optimal performance across the entire engine speed range.
  • Common-Rail Injection: The advanced X-Pulse common-rail injection system injects fuel at extremely high pressures, ensuring efficient combustion and reduced emissions.
  • Exhaust Gas Treatment: Complies with the latest Euro VI emission standards through advanced SCR (Selective Catalytic Reduction) technology, making it an environmentally conscious choice.

The OM 473 Engine: For Maximum Demands

When the going gets exceptionally tough, or when very high power and torque are non-negotiable, the OM 473 engine steps in. This larger displacement engine is built for the most demanding applications, such as heavy-haulage or operation in challenging geographical conditions.

  • Power Output: Can reach up to 625 hp, providing immense capability for the most strenuous tasks.
  • Torque: Offers colossal torque figures, often surpassing 3,000 Nm, enabling effortless movement of exceptionally heavy loads.
  • Robust Construction: Designed with reinforced components to withstand extreme operational stress and deliver long-term reliability.
  • Tiered Performance: Available in different power levels to match specific heavy-duty requirements without compromising efficiency excessively.

Intelligent Powertrain: The Transmission and Drivetrain Synergy

Intelligent Powertrain: The Transmission and Drivetrain Synergy

Power from the engine needs to be delivered effectively to the wheels. The Actros employs advanced transmission and drivetrain technologies to ensure this happens smoothly, efficiently, and with maximum control.

Mercedes PowerShift 3: Seamless Gear Shifting

The standard transmission for most Actros models is the automated manual transmission (AMT) known as Mercedes PowerShift 3. This system is far more than just an automatic gearbox; it’s an intelligent transmission that communicates with the engine control unit to optimize gear changes.

  • Smooth Shifts: The PowerShift 3 ensures incredibly smooth gear changes, minimizing load interruption and enhancing driver comfort, which is crucial on long journeys.
  • Optimized Shifting Patterns: It automatically selects the most fuel-efficient gear based on driving style, load, road gradient, and speed.
  • Direct Control: Drivers can manually override the system or select specific driving modes (e.g., Power, Eco) for tailored performance.
  • Creep Function: Facilitates precise maneuvering at low speeds, especially helpful in congested areas or during docking.

The intelligence of the PowerShift 3, combined with the powerhouse engines, creates a harmonious powertrain that’s both responsive and economical.

Drivetrain Configurations: From 4×2 to 8×4

The Actros is available in a multitude of axle configurations to suit virtually any application. These configurations directly impact the truck’s tractive power, load distribution, and maneuverability.

Configuration Description Typical Application
4×2 One driven rear axle, one non-driven front axle. Long-haul, distribution, lighter loads. Offers the best fuel economy.
6×2 Two rear axles, one of which is driven, and one non-driven front axle. Often features a lift or steerable trailing axle. Long-haul with higher Gross Vehicle Weight (GVW), increased traction, load flexibility.
6×4 Two driven rear axles and one non-driven front axle. Heavy-duty, construction, off-road applications where maximum traction is needed.
8×4 Two driven rear axles, two non-driven front axles. Super heavy-duty applications, concrete mixers, tippers, special transport.

The choice of drivetrain is critical for performance. A 6×4 or 8×4 configuration, for example, will offer superior tractive effort compared to a 4×2, enabling the truck to start moving heavy loads from a standstill or climb steep gradients more effectively.

Intelligent Driver Assistance Systems: Enhancing Performance and Safety

Intelligent Driver Assistance Systems: Enhancing Performance and Safety

Modern trucks are as much about intelligence as they are about brute force. The Actros integrates a suite of advanced driver assistance systems that not only enhance safety but also optimize performance and fuel efficiency.

Predictive Powertrain Control (PPC)

PPC is perhaps one of the most impactful technologies for maximizing performance and efficiency. It utilizes GPS data, 3D map information, and driving dynamics sensors to anticipate the road ahead. Before reaching a hill, PPC can:

  • Optimize Gear Shifting: Select the most efficient gear to maintain momentum, often allowing the truck to coast downhill to save fuel.
  • Control Speed: Automatically adjust the vehicle’s speed to carry momentum into inclines, minimizing unnecessary acceleration and deceleration.
  • Reduce Brake Wear: By managing speed more effectively, it reduces reliance on service brakes.

This system essentially allows the truck to “think ahead,” making driving smoother, more economical, and less demanding for the driver.

Aerodynamics and Fuel Efficiency: The Performance Multiplier

Aerodynamics and Fuel Efficiency: The Performance Multiplier

In the world of heavy-duty trucking, fuel efficiency is a critical aspect of overall performance. A truck that can cover more distance on less fuel is more profitable and environmentally friendly. The Actros has been designed with aerodynamics as a key consideration.

  • Streamlined Cab Design: The cab’s contours are sculpted to minimize air resistance.
  • Air Dams and Fairings: Integrated spoilers and side-mounted air deflectors guide airflow smoothly around the truck.
  • Gap Optimization: Careful attention is paid to minimizing gaps between the tractor unit and trailer, as well as between different body sections, to prevent turbulence.
  • Wheel Arch Covers: Reduce air resistance around the wheels.

These aerodynamic enhancements, combined with the efficient engines and intelligent transmission, contribute significantly to the Actros’s reputation for class-leading fuel economy, even when delivering ultimate power.
